Quick Fix: Preserve Momentum Before Changing the Route

Most OvO failures come from entering an obstacle too slowly or spending the dive too early. Rebuild the run-up first, then change only one input at a time.

  • Slide-jump: slide while running, then jump to carry speed across a longer gap.
  • Dive-bounce: press down in the air, then jump as you land to convert the dive into extra height.
  • Wall jump: hold toward a wall and jump to kick off it; alternate walls to climb vertical shafts.

OvO is a minimalist parkour platformer where a small runner jumps, slides, dives, and wall-jumps toward each flag. The official Dedra Games mobile listing says there are more than 50 levels, while browser editions and later community builds can show a different total or order. Check the version and obstacle layout before following a numbered solution.

How to Beat OvO Level 46 in the Common Browser Layout

If your Level 46 starts with spikes, a spring, and portals, slide-jump over the first spikes and hit the spring. Enter the next portal, move carefully through the spike section, and use the walls as cover from the rockets.

  • At the first wall of three portals, take the bottom green portal.
  • At the next three-portal wall, take the middle red portal.
  • In the final room, use the blue portal and the right-side wall to arrive just above the flag.

How Many Levels Are in OvO?

There is no single reliable total across every copy in circulation. Dedra Games describes the official mobile release as having more than 50 levels. Browser hosts and community-enhanced versions may add, remove, or renumber sections, so the level selector and obstacle layout in your current build are the authoritative check.

Speedrunning & Hard Mode

OvO tracks your deaths and time, and there is a hard mode plus advanced replay options for runners. If you want faster times, the priority is never braking — link dive-jumps so you carry speed between obstacles instead of resetting it at every platform.

Browser and Mobile Notes

OvO is available in browsers and as a Dedra Games mobile release. Touch controls and performance vary by device and host. Use a normal browser tab, avoid unofficial installers or extensions, and switch to keyboard controls when precise wall jumps feel inconsistent on touch.

How do you jump higher in OvO?
Use a dive-jump: press down to dive while running, then jump the moment you land. This carries your speed and gives you far more height and distance than a standing jump.
Why does an OvO walkthrough not match my level?
Different browser hosts and game versions can renumber or add levels. Match the obstacles and section name, not only the number, before following a route.
